=====[[Craftworld Saim-Hann|Saim-Hann]]===== *Fluff about Saim-Hann society and some of its more colorful rituals, like their preference for settling disagreements via ritual duels. *Each clan is free to choose whether or not to fight for a given cause, and in some cases a clan may go to war without the approval of the rest of the Craftworld. *An entire Wild Rider Clan and part of the Craftworld itself were infected when just two Vectorums of the Death Guard managed to fight through and board the Craftworld. Although eventually driven off the Eldar are forced to cut loose the infected piece of their home, the resulting despair causing every member of the lost Wild Rider Clan to be possessed by a Daemon of Nurgle and transform into weird insect monsters. *Hive Fleets Scylla and Charybdis are both headed towards Saim-Hann; as befitting their namesakes, they have surrounded in a way that the Craftworld can only evade one by putting itself into the path of the other.
